Valley of Flowers highlights 600+ blooms
- The Valley of Flowers UNESCO site is being spotlighted for National Walking Month, noted for its 600+ alpine flower species and the chance—rare but possible—to spot snow leopards. - Social posts are sharing photos and trail suggestions that emphasize the site’s high alpine blooms and seasonal accessibility for hikers and photographers. - For those planning visits, the Valley of Flowers is being pitched as a prime high‑altitude walking destination this spring and summer.
